British singer Phil Collins has landed his first number one album in the U.K. for 12 years - his covers compilation GOING BACK is at the top of the rundown.
The former Genesis star, who previously topped the list with 1998's ...Hits, pushed last week's (end19Sep10) number one The Script into second place with Science & Faith, while the Manic Street Preachers' Postcards From A Young Man debuted at number three.
Brandon Flowers' solo record Flamingo and Robert Plant's Band Of Joy album rounded out the top five.
Meanwhile R&B star Bruno Mars topped the U.K. singles chart with his track Just The Way You Are (Amazing), while Taio Cruz landed second spot with Dynamite.
Katy Perry's Teenage Dream, The Script's For The First Time and Start Without You by Alexandra Burke rounded out the top five.
